Our guest – Ian Ridpath

A professional broadcaster and writer on the subject of astronomy since the early 1970s, Ian Ridpath is the author of Collins Stars and Planets Guide. He is also the editor of Norton’s Star Atlas and the Oxford Dictionary of Astronomy.

Away from the telescope Ian is a skeptically minded investigator of UFO cases. In 1983 his Guardian article ‘A Flashlight in the Forest’ shattered the notion that a UFO had crashed in Rendlesham Forest, Suffolk, and had been followed by US Air Force personnel. In this interview Ian revisits the case and clears up the complexities and misconceptions that keep it a holy grail for UFO believers.

Ep.5 - Simon Singh

Guest Simon Singh:
One of the most versatile figures in British skepticism, Simon Singh is a former producer of the BBC science show 'Tomorrow's World'. He is the author of 'The Code Book', 'Big Bang' and 'Fermat's Last Theorem'. His most recent book 'Trick or Treatment', co-authored with Edzard Ernst, lays bare the body of evidence related to a range of complementary and alternative therapies.

Episode seven of Righteous Indignation is now online. News items include the crop circle that predicts a solar storm, death of Mothman author and Argentinian cattle mutilations.

Our guest is Professor Chris French, co-editor of ‘The Skeptic’ magazine and co-ordinator of the Anomalistic Psychology Research Unit at Goldsmiths, University of London. He joins Righteous Indignation to discuss the work of the APRU, the testing of medium Patricia Putt for the Randi $1 challenge and his role as resident skeptic on ITV’s ‘Haunted Homes’ television series.

They seem to be claiming now they "hit" on a "coronal mass ejection" on July 6 and a "smaller" one on July 7. CMEs might well be common. It's like saying "I bet someone will be killed in a car accident on July 7" and someone is killed in a car accident on July 6 and someone is injured on July 7. And then I claim an astounding hit.
